Offset sparks dating rumors with Dreka Gates after IG repost, as Cardi B moves on with Stefon Diggs [PHOTO]

The Migos rapper fueled speculation he’s moved on from Cardi B by sharing Kevin Gates’ ex-wife’s photoshoot with his track “Different Species.”

Offset triggered fresh gossip after reposting Dreka Gates’ recent photoshoot to his Instagram Story, soundtracked by his own track “Different Species.” The move immediately set off speculation that the popular rapper, separated from Cardi B, has “moved on” with Kevin Gates’ ex-wife.

Offset reposted Dreka on his IG Story, now fans are debating whether the two are dating or not.

The repost wasn’t subtle. Overlayed with the lyric, “Shawty a baddie, she belong to me,” fans connected dots between the sultry images of Dreka in a red gown and Offset’s playful claim of ownership. Within hours, screenshots flooded X, where the original clip racked up more than 130,000 views in less than two hours.

While Offset has a long history of sparking rumors with his social media activity, the timing—just days after Cardi B confirmed being pregnant by Stefon Diggs—made the Dreka repost land harder. It reads less like promotion and more like a pointed message.

Dreka Gates: Fresh Start After Kevin Gates Divorce

Dreka, best known as the longtime partner and manager of rapper Kevin Gates, finalized her divorce earlier this year after nearly a decade of marriage. She’s since focused on brand partnerships, lifestyle content, and fitness ventures, including modeling collaborations like the red-themed CandyLyne campaign featured in Offset’s repost.

The photoshoot, which showcased her in a form-fitting red gown against a luxury backdrop, was already gaining traction among her fans. Offset’s repost catapulted it into gossip territory, reframing it from influencer content to potential “soft launch” romance fuel.

Her supporters point out that Dreka has shown no signs of being romantically linked to Offset herself. For now, her Instagram remains focused on family, wellness, and professional projects. But social media thrives on speculation—and Offset provided the spark.

Cardi B Backdrop: A Turbulent History with Offset

Offset and Cardi B’s marriage has always lived under the microscope. From cheating scandals and public reconciliations to Cardi’s recently confirmed relationship with NFL star Stefon Diggs, the pair’s eight-year history has been a constant news cycle.

By September 2024, signs of strain were undeniable. Cardi was being spotted without her wedding ring, while Offset has leaned into solo promotion and subtle digs. Their separation, while not formally finalized, was already feeding tabloid narratives about rebounds and replacements.

Offset’s repost of Dreka Gates, a year later, enters that narrative at full volume. Whether calculated or careless, it shifts attention from his marital fallout with Cardi to a new potential flame, playing directly into the entertainment world’s obsession with “rap couples.”

Is It Promo or Pettiness?

Skeptics argue the Dreka repost was less about romance and more about marketing. Dreka had already used Offset’s “Different Species” track in a video reel promoting her photoshoot. Offset may have simply amplified her content to spotlight his own music.

That explanation tracks with his history—Offset frequently reposts fan edits and influencer reels that use his songs. By that logic, Dreka’s feature was nothing personal, just business.

But critics note the added lyrics—particularly “she belong to me”—and the red-themed imagery made it impossible not to interpret as shade toward Cardi. Even if Offset’s intentions were promotional, the perception was pure gossip fodder.
